Sunday Igboho Issues Ultimatum Over Kidnapped Pregnant Woman

Yoruba Nation activist, Sunday Igboho, has issued a two‑hour ultimatum to Fulani leaders, demanding the release of the corpse of a pregnant woman who was kidnapped in Oyo State.

According to reports, suspected Fulani gunmen abducted the woman and her sibling during a midnight raid in the Igboho area. The incident has heightened tensions in the region, with Igboho warning that failure to comply with his demand could trigger consequences.

The activist, known for his fiery stance against insecurity in the southwest, framed the ultimatum as a call for justice and accountability. Community members say the kidnapping underscores the persistent threat of armed groups targeting rural households.
